1Optimization and kinetic studies for enzymatic hydrolysis and fermentation of colocynthis vulgaris Shrad seeds shell for bioethanol production显示文摘The key process parameters for the hydrolysis and fermentation of Colocynthis vulgaris Shrad seeds shell(CVSSS)were optimized using the Box-Behnken Design(BBD)of Response Surface Methodology(RSM).Kinetic study was also carried out.The proximate analysis of the CVSSS was done by the method of the Association of Organic and Applied Chemistry(AOAC).Enzymatic hydrolysis was experimented by using Aspergillus Niger as a crude enzyme isolated from soil at sawdust dump site and screened for cellulosic activities.Factors that affected the hydrolysis of the CVSSS were screened by using the Greco-Latin square design of experiment.However,for Saccharomyces cerevisiae,factors that affected the fermentation of the CVSSS were screened by using the same Greco-Latin square design of experiment.Meanwhile,the result of the proximate analysis revealed that the CVSSS had 73.54%cellulose which could be converted to bioethanol.It was established that temperature,pH and time had significant effect on hydrolysis,while the optimum results were obtained at 46.8℃,3.32 d,5.68 and 59.87%for temperature,time,pH and glucose yield,respectively.Temperature,yeast dosage,pH and time had significant effect on fermentation,while the optimum results from optimization were found to be 33.58℃,7.0,3.55 d,1.65 g per 50 mL and 25.6%for temperature,pH,time,yeast dosage and ethanol yield,respectively.The kinetics of both the enzymatic hydrolysis and fermentation agreed with the Michealis-Menten kinetic model with the correlation coefficients(R^(2))of 0.9708 and 0.8773,respectively.However,from the error analysis,the experimental and predicted values had a very good relationship as described by Michaelis-Menten model.Igwilo Christopher Nnaemeka Egbuna Samuel O Onoh Maxwell I Asadu OChristain Onyekwulu Chinelo S 2021Journal of Bioresources and Bioproducts2021,6,1:3

4Accessibility and utilization of healthcare services among diabetic patients:Is diabetes a poor man’s ailment?显示文摘Diabetes is a non-communicable ailment that has adverse effects on the individual’s overall well-being and productivity in society.The main objective of this study was to examine the empirical literature concerning the association between diabetes and poverty and the accessibility and utilization of medical care services among diabetic patients.The diabetes literature was explored using a literature review approach.This review revealed that diabetes is an ailment that affects all individuals irrespective of socioeconomic status;however,its prevalence is high in low-income countries.Hence,despite the higher prevalence of diabetes in developing countries compared with developed countries,diabetes is not a poor man’s ailment because it affects individuals of all incomes.While the number of diabetic patients that access and utilize diabetes medical care services has increased over the years,some personal and institutional factors still limit patients’access to the use of diabetes care.Also,there is a lacuna in the diabetes literature concerning the extent of utilization of available healthcare services by diabetic patients.Chiedu Eseadi Amos Nnaemeka Amedu Leonard Chidi Ilechukwu Millicent O Ngwu Osita Victor Ossai 2023World Journal of Diabetes2023,14,10:1

6Influence of automobile industrial wastewater on soil quality显示文摘Reuse of industrial wastewater(effluent)for irrigation purpose is a common practice.However,lack of adequate treatment of the effluent can cause soil deterioration,vegetation destruction and contamination of the aquatic environment.These adverse effects necessitated the study of wastewater irrigation in Emene Industrial Layout,Enugu State,Nigeria.Wastewater and soil samples were collected,analyzed and subjected to Analysis of Variance(ANOVA)for Completely Randomized Design(CRD)at 5% probability level using GENSTAT software.The results obtained from the study were compared with FAO soil and water standards.The wastewater analysis suggested that contamination at the untreated stage was very high and results at the treatment level were within the FAO reuse range.The study also found wide variation in chemical status of industrial wastewater treated soil.Almost all the values for the wastewater treated soil were not within the FAO irrigated soil chemical properties standards.This suggests high re-contamination along the open channel(from non-point sources)before reuse.This calls for proper monitoring and treatment of the industrial effluent prior to irrigation application.Ugwu Samson Nnaemeka Anyadike Chinenye Chukwuemeka Echiegu Emmanuel Nwoke Oji Achuka Ugwuishiwu Boniface 2014International Journal of Agricultural and Biological Engineering2014,7,6:1

8Dietary Fibre and Fatty Acid Evaluation of Boiled, Roasted, Germinated and Fermented Breadnut (Ukwa bekee) Seed Flours显示文摘Evaluation of dietary fiber and fatty acid composition of boiled, roasted, fermented and germinated breadnut seed flour was investigated. The seeds were dehulled and washed. It was divided into four equal parts for different processing techniques: boiled, roasted, germinated and fermented. They were analyzed for dietary fibre and fatty acid composition using standard methods. Data were subjected to statistical analysis using Statistical Product for Service Solution (SPSS) version 23.0. Values were expressed as means and standard deviation, Duncan multiple range test was used in separating the means at 95% confidence interval. Dietary fibre composition showed that breadnut seed flours range from 4.94%(fermented breadnut seed flour) to 5.42%(roasted breadnut seed flour). Fatty acid profile showed that breadnut seed flours contain a greater amount of non-essential fatty acids which were highly significant (p < 0.05) in oleic acid (57.93%) for roasted breadnut seed flour followed by linoleic acid (25.76%) in fermented breadnut flour. Stearic acid was the only prominent non-essential fatty acid in the breadnut seed flour and ranged from 4.40%(fermented breadnut seed flour) to 6.27%(germinated breadnut seed flour). The study revealed that all the processed breadnut seed flours have appreciable quantities of dietary fibre and essential fatty acids than non-essential fatty acids. Breadnut seed should be recommended in wheat substitution in bakery industry and culinary uses. It is also recommended for weight loss program.Joy Adaku. C. 9Index model equation analysis:A case study of the risk and source of inorganic contaminants in roadside uncontaminated soil of the Egi oil producing area,Niger Delta显示文摘This study examined the sources,health risk and pollution status of selected inorganic contaminants such as iron(Fe),nickel(Ni),cadmium(Cd),cobalt(Co),arsenic(As),manganese(Mn),lead(Pb),copper(Cu),zinc(Zn),and chromium(Cr)in representative roadside uncontaminated soil(n?72)from the Egi crude oil mining areas(Oboburu,Obagi,and Ogbogu),Niger Delta,Nigeria,using a combination of multiple models(Principle component analysis(PCA),correlation analysis,geo-accumulation index(Igeo),contamination factor(CF),enrichment factor(EF),pollution load index(PLI),cancer risk(CR),hazard quotient(HQ),and metal daily intake(MDIm)).A random sampling method was applied in the sampling and analysis using inductively coupled plasma mass spectroscopy.The result revealed that the mean(mg/kg)for Oboburu,was the highest for Fe(89.95±28.83)and Mn(26.12±7.642),whereas Obagi,had less Fe(28.90±7.601)and Mn(16.80±5.021),and Ogbogu,Fe(44.67±28.15)and Pb(19.38±8.731)was the second highest heavy metal.The order of contaminationwas F>Mn>Zn>Pb>Cu>Cr>Ni>Cd>Co.The Igeo and CF had cadmium as a metal of concern.The contamination level was low from the PLI estimation.The EF revealed anthropogenic sources for all the metals except for Ni,which was biogenic.The correlations at p<0.05 and p<0.01 showed much positive significance amongst the metals.Variations of the cumulative percentages,loading percentages,and eigenvalues from the regression plot gave a coefficients of determination(r^(2))of 0.9936,0.9995,and 0.9994,respectively.The PCA indicated that Cd and Ni were of anthropogenic origin;Mn,Fe,and Co were biogenic or natural,and Zn and Pb were of mixed origins.The CR assessment indicated a possible cancer risk due to Cr,Cd,and Ni,and the rest of elements have no carcinogenic risk.These findings suggest there should be regular monitoring,source control,and integrated environmental management of the study area.Elechi Owhoeke Asmat Ali Okorondu Justin Nnaemeka Kingsley John Orie Julius Nkeonyeasua Ehiwario Abdur Rashid 2023International Journal of Sediment Research2023,38,6:0
10Quality of life and depression among patients with high myopia in Nigeria:a cross sectional study显示文摘AIM:To evaluate the quality of life(QOL)and level of depression among participants with high myopia in Nigeria and the demographic factors associated with these outcomes.METHODS:This cross-sectional study was conducted on 100 adult participants with high myopia(defined as refractive error≤-5.00 D or worse,and uncorrected visual acuity worse than 6/18 in the better seeing eye)attending ophthalmology centres in Nigeria from 2 October 2021 to 30 August 2022.The means and standard deviations were calculated for each of the four domains of World Health Organization Quality of life scale(WHOQOL-BREF)using the transformed scores.The Beck Depression Inventory(BDI)scale was used to assess the level of depression.RESULTS:The highest and the lowest mean scores of WHOQOL-BREF domains were found for the psychological and physical health domains(mean percentage scores were 67.0[95% confidence intervals(CI)64.1-68.9]and 55.3(95%CI 51.8-58.8,P<0.001),respectively.One-way analysis of variance(ANOVA)revealed significant differences in physical health with educational status(higher among those with tertiary education:mean difference 0.9,95%CI-0.2-2.1;P=0.049),differences in psychological health with working status(higher among those who were working 1.2,95%CI 0.3-2.1;P=0.012).Also,the result showed a statistically significant association between environmental health and marital status(higher among non-married:1.7,95%CI-0.9-2.3;P=0.012)while overall health was associated with place of residence(higher in urban areas:2.3,95%CI 1.2-3.5;P=0.024).For depression,one in every nine participants reported major depressive symptom,mostly younger people(aged 16-29 vs 30-49y:17.0%vs 0,P=0.019),and slightly more women than men(14.3%vs 0,P=0.064).There were significant negative correlations between the depression scores and psychological health(r=-0.48,P<0.001),physical health(r=-0.29,P=0.002),social and relationship(r=-0.49,P<0.001),environmental(r=-0.48,P<0.001)and overall health(r=-0.49,P<0.001)CONCLUSION:People with high myopia have a relatively moderate QOL,but poor physical health,particularly the younger age group,and women who are more likely to experience clinically relevant depression.Eye care professionals should consider possible referrals for counselling for people with high myopia.Uchechukwu Levi Osuagwu Kelechukwu Enyinnaya Ahaiwe Nnaemeka Meribe ElizabethDennis Nkanga Bernadine Nsa Ekpenyong Affiong Andem Ibanga Piwuna ChristopherGoson Dennis George Nkanga 2023International Journal of Ophthalmology(English edition)2023,16,12:0

13Geoelectrical Investigation of Groundwater Potentials of Northern Paiko,Niger State,North Central Nigeria显示文摘Vertical electrical sounding(VES) was carried out in northern part of Paiko, North Central Nigeria, using Abem terrameter model SAS 4000 to determine the subsurface layer parameters(resistivities, depths and thickness) employed in delineating the groundwater potential of the area. A total of six transverses with ten VES stations along each traverse, at intervals of 50 m were investigated. It has a maximum current electrode separation(AB/2) of 100 m. Three to four distinct geoelectric layers were observed, namely, the top layer, the weathered layer, the fractured/fresh layer, and the fresh basement layer. The observed frequencies in curve types include 21% of H, 4.2% of HA, 2.4% of K, 4.2% of A, 1.67% of KH and 3% of HK. Eight VES stations were delineated as ground water potentials of the area, with third and fourth layer resistivities ranging from 191 to 398 ?·m. Depths range from 13.60 to 36.60 m and thickness varies from 9.23 to 30.51 m. A correlation of the borehole log with the VES lithology is in agreement. Viable boreholes for good portable water should be sited at VES stations J8 and J10 having a fine aquifer at a depth of 36.60 and 17.80 m respectively with thickness of 30.51 and 15.07 m, respectively.Usman D.Alhassan Daniel Nnaemeka Obiora Francisca Nneka Okeke 2017Journal of Earth Science2017,28,1:0
14Electrical geophysical evaluation of susceptibility to flooding in University of Nigeria, Nsukka main campus and its environs, Southeastern Nigeria显示文摘Flooding occurs when rainfall exceeds the absorption capacity of soil and causes significant environmental consequences.In this study,electrical resistivity techniques were employed to assess the flood susceptibility of the study area by examining variations in electrical properties.Prior to flooding,Vertical Electrical Sounding(VES)and Electrical Resistivity Tomography(ERT)profiles were conducted to determine the variations in resistivity within subsurface lithologies exposed to the injected current.The injected current penetrated the subsurface units characterised by resistivity ranging from 190.5Ω·m to 6,775.7Ω·m,42.3Ω·m to 7,297.4Ω·m,and 320.2Ω·m to 24,433.3Ω·m in the first,second and third layers,respectively.These layers were identified as lateritic topsoil,medium-coarse brownish grained sand,and coarse pebbly blackish sand,respectively.The calculated reflection coefficients between layers 1,2,and 3 reveal alternation in layers with values ranging from−0.04 to 0.66 and 0.36 to 0.95 for and,respectively.The transverse resistivity,longitudinal resistivity and anisotropy ranged from 243.59Ω·m to 24,115.42Ω·m,199.61Ω·m to 14,950.76Ω·m,and 1.02 to 2.14.Models derived from the ERT profiles reveal variations in resistivity,pinpointing areas of low resistivity which correspond to waterlogged and impermeable layers.The result of this study underscores the importance of integrated resistivity techniques in the study of floods,as it provides valuable insights into flood behaviour,and subsurface dynamics.Daniel Nnaemeka Obiora Johnson Cletus Ibuot 2023Journal of Groundwater Science and Engineering2023,11,4:0

17Transition to cleaner cooking energy in Ghana显示文摘Progress towards the Sustainable Development Goal 7 and other related goals hinges on increased access to clean energy alternatives for all people irrespective of where they live.However,most developing countries including Ghana still rely largely on traditional biomass as the main source of household energy as a result of a myriad of challenges.From the foregoing,the present study uses the Ghana Living Standard Survey 7(GLSS 7)household data and the multinomial logit regression model to analyse the factors that determine the transition to cleaner cooking energy in Ghana.The analysis shows that the main determinants of household energy choice in Ghana are education,household dwelling type,household size,employment and income group.Whereas education,modern housing,paid employment and higher income increase the adoption of cleaner energy,a higher dependency ratio and employment in the informal sector increase the likelihood of using unclean energy.Increased access to education and the adoption of policies to improve housing conditions,employment and incomes are recommended to encourage the adoption of cleaner energy alternatives.Richard Osei Bofah Paul Appiah-Konadu Franklin Nnaemeka Ngwu 2022Clean Energy2022,6,1:0
18陆地棉GhrbcMT基因克隆、表达与功能初步分析显示文摘植物的rbcMT基因编码核酮糖1,5-二磷酸羧化酶/加氧酶大亚基N-甲基转移酶(ribulose1,5 bisphosphate carboxylase/oxygenase large subunitε-N-methyltransferase, rbcMT),可能催化双功能酶核酮糖1,5-二磷酸羧化酶/加氧酶大亚基14位赖氨酸的ε-氨基的甲基化过程,目前在豌豆、小麦、烟草等中被鉴定出,可能参与调控植物生长发育,但有关GhrbcMT基因生物学功能研究尚未报道。该研究以陆地棉(Gossypium hirsutum L.)为材料,提取叶片总RNA,反转录合成cDNA,利用PCR技术克隆棉花核酮糖1,5-二磷酸加氧酶/羧化酶大亚基甲基转移酶基因(GhrbcMT)全长cDNA,对该基因进行生物信息学分析,采用荧光定量PCR(qRT-PCR)对GhrbcMT基因进行组织特异性表达分析,并用病毒诱导的基因沉默(virus-induced gene silencing, VIGS)技术降低GhrbcMT在植株中的表达水平,同时用乙醇浸泡法提取野生型与GhrbcMT干涉株系的叶片叶绿素进行含量分析。结果显示, GhrbcMT蛋白质序列存在多个潜在磷酸化与糖基化位点, Loop结构占56.94%,构象灵活。GhrbcMT基因在棉花叶片中特异性表达, GhrbcMT干涉株系的GhrbcMT表达水平显著降低,棉花出现明显的生长缓慢、节间距缩短、植株矮小、花药败育等表型, GhrbcMT基因表达水平的降低对棉花植株的营养生长和育性具有显著影响。该研究通过对1,5-二磷酸核酮糖加氧酶/羧化酶大亚基甲基转移酶功能初步探究,为进一步探究植株生长发育和育性调控机理提供参考。张梦娜 沈丽 Nnaemeka Ekene Vitalis 孙玉强 柯丽萍 2019中国细胞生物学学报2019,41,7:0
19Significance of fostering the mental health of patients with diabetes through critical time intervention显示文摘BACKGROUND Critical time intervention(CTI)is an evidence-based model of practice that is time-limited and aims to provide support for most susceptible individuals during a transition period.AIM To examine the significance of fostering the mental health of diabetes patients through CTI using the scoping review methodology.METHODS As part of the scoping review process,we followed the guidelines established by the Joanna Briggs Institute.The search databases were Google Scholar,PubMed,Scopus,PsycINFO,Reference Citation Analysis(https://www.referencecitation-analysis.com/),and Cochrane Library.From these databases,77 articles were retrieved with the aid of carefully selected search terms.However,19 studies were selected after two reviewers appraised the full texts to ensure that they are all eligible for inclusion,while 54 papers were excluded.RESULTS This study revealed that diabetic patients who had experienced homelessness were at higher risk of being diagnosed with mental illness and that social support services are impactful in the management of the comorbidity of diabetes and mental health problems.In addition,this review reveals that CTI is impactful in enhancing the mental health of homeless patients during the transitional period from the hospital through social support services.CONCLUSION CTI is a promising intervention for alleviating mental health symptoms in homeless patients.Empirical studies are needed across the globe,involving both hospitalized and community-based patients,to determine how clinically effectively CTI is in managing the mental health of diabetics.Chiedu Eseadi Amos Nnaemeka Amedu Henry Egi Aloh 2023World Journal of Clinical Cases2023,11,36:0
